  3. Leaves curling in on themselves can be a sign of aphid damage
    Get rid of the gnats, they can cause damage to your plants. The grubs in particular like to munch on organic matter and your plant roots. However Im not certain if thats the issue. Maybe someone more experienced will help better than I can. Id still check the under sides of your leaves make sure you have no mites or aphids, I noticed some of your leaves are curling in on themselves. This can be a sign of mites, aphids, or could be under watering causing the curling.
